Vibratory Feeder Coil | Kendrion
An OAC series oscillating solenoid consists of a UI core and two excitation windings connected in series. In 16 sizes, the vibratory feeder coil can be continuously regulated at OP via the operating voltage and frequency (24 - 230 V AC, 15-50 Hz). The vibratory feeder drive is supplied without a spring-mass system.

Electromagnetic vibrating feeder working principle
Figure 2 (a) shows the working principle of the electromagnetic vibrating feeder. The material 2 is placed on the supply tank body 1 supported by the main vibration spring 3, and the armature 4 is integrally connected with the main vibration spring of the tank body, and the coil 6 is wound around the iron core 5.

Electromagnetic Vibrating Feeder
The electromagnetic vibrating feeder uses the principle of mechanical dynamics, and the electromagnetic vibrator drives the feed trough to move periodically along the direction of the trough. When an electromagnetic coil is energized, a magnetic field is produced. This field attracts and repels the armature, causing the tray or slot to vibrate.

How do electromagnetic vibratory feeder works | MP …
The vibration of an electromagnetic feeder is generated as the alternating electrical current moves back and forward through the wires of the coil. As the current moves in one direction, the coil attracts the magnet and adds tension to the springs.

Vibratory Feeders in the Manufacturing Industry
Electromagnetic vibratory feeders from Eriez are available with electromagnetic drives that can be used in a Class II hazardous dust environment in groups F and G, as defined by the National Fire Protection Association. Eriez also has specially built drives that can operate in temperatures up to 300 degrees F.
